    Stanton House is a sleek, modern hotel located in the heart of downtown El Paso, with the arts district, museums, theaters, stadium, and restaurants all in easy walking distance. The rooms are well appointed and comfortable, and the "art view" window in certain rooms is particularly fun. The hotel itself offers friendly, professional service throughout, including at the front desk and in the Taft-Diaz restaurant just off the lobby (oh, that espresso and delicious avocado toast).

The hotel has this amazing art installation in the form of several beautiful lighting fixtures on motors that move up and down several stories inside the hotel. Our room did not have a window to the outside, instead it had a window overlooking the moving light installation, which was AWESOME, until it wasn't. At about 1 PM, when there were no curtains to close and the the lights were still swishing up and down outside the window, it wasn't awesome any more. Luckily its a simple fix for the hotel so that next time this can be a five star review, just a nice thick, light blocking curtain on the window allows the guests to get a good night's sleep, which is, after all, one of the main reasons they checked in here in the first place.
